> Open the same symlink file with two emacs instances, then modify the
> file in one instance and save it, file in the other instance can't be
> auto-reverted.
Likely, this is because we use file notification for auto-revert in
Emacs 24.4. I've submitted a patch, which excludes symlinked files from
this mechanism. Could you, please, test whether it works for you?
